What is carbon capture storage bbc bitesize? Carbon capture – this is the removal of carbon dioxide from waste gases from power stations and then storing it in old oil and gas fields or coal mines underground. This reduces the amount of emissions into the atmosphere.
What is carbon capture and storage? Carbon capture and storage (CCS) is the process of capturing and storing carbon dioxide (CO2) before it is released into the atmosphere. The technology can capture up to 90% of CO2 released by burning fossil fuels in electricity generation and industrial processes such as cement production.
What is carbon capture and storage GCSE? Carbon capture and storage is a way to prevent carbon dioxide building up in the atmosphere. It is a rapidly evolving technology that involves separating carbon dioxide from waste gases. The carbon dioxide is then stored underground, for example in old oil or gas fields such as those found under the North Sea.
What is captured carbon used for? Captured carbon dioxide can be put to productive use in enhanced oil recovery and the manufacture of fuels, building materials, and more, or be stored in underground geologic formations.

What is decomposition of carbonic acid?
Since we always prepare carbonic acid in the presence of water, it decomposes immediately into water and carbon dioxide: H₂CO₃ → H₂O + CO₂ Even in pressurized soft drinks, the concentration of carbon dioxide is about 600 times the concentration of carbonic acid.

How does methane compared to carbon dioxide?
Methane’s lifetime in the atmosphere is much shorter than carbon dioxide (CO2), but CH4 is more efficient at trapping radiation than CO2. Pound for pound, the comparative impact of CH4 is 25 times greater than CO2 over a 100-year period.

How is there carbon if there is water?
Carbon dioxide, also called CO2, is found in water as a dissolved gas. It can dissolve in water 200 times more easily than oxygen. Aquatic plants depend on carbon dioxide for life and growth, just as fish depend on oxygen. Plants use carbon dioxide during the process of photosynthesis.
What is the weight of carbon in co2?
The weight of CO2 is 44 grams per mole (1 x 12 grams/mole for the carbon and 2 x 16 grams/mole for the oxygen atoms).

How to test a first alert carbon monoxide alarm?
You can test this CO Alarm by pressing the Test button on the Alarm cover until alarm chirps. The alarm horn will sound: 4 beeps, a pause, then 4 beeps. The alarm sequence should last 5-6 seconds. If the unit does not alarm, make sure it has been activated correctly, and test again.

Do all plants give off carbon dioxide at night?
While many plants release carbon dioxide, not oxygen, at night, having a few plants in the bedroom will not release enough carbon dioxide to be harmful at all. Also, not all plants release carbon dioxide at night. Some still release oxygen even when they are not in the process of photosynthesis.

Do dryers produce carbon monoxide?
Prevent Carbon Monoxide Poisoning: Many dryers emit carbon monoxide. With a normally functioning dryer vent system, the carbon monoxide is vented outdoors. However, clogs can prevent the gas from escaping the building. A buildup of carbon monoxide is very dangerous and can result in illness and death.

What emits carbon monoxide in your home?
Carbon monoxide is created by the burning of fuels, so houses with fuel-burning appliances and attached garages are more susceptible to carbon monoxide leaks. Some potential sources of CO are: … Furnaces, dryers, water heaters and space heaters — In some homes, these appliances are powered by burning fuel.

Do you run a fever with carbon monoxide poisoning?
The symptoms of exposure to low levels of carbon monoxide can be similar to those of food poisoning and flu. But unlike flu, carbon monoxide poisoning doesn’t cause a high temperature (fever). The symptoms can gradually get worse with long periods of exposure to carbon monoxide, leading to a delay in diagnosis.
